Combining eye gaze and speech recognition as a selection technique was investigated using the ISO9241-9 multidirectional tapping task. Twenty participants were tested on 14 conditions with varying target size, magnification capabilities and presence of a gravity well. Data analysis will determine whether this is a viable alternative to the mouse.

<p class="5abstrak">The Implementation of education in Higher Education must have the vision and mission to achieve a certain goal. The result of the vision and mission statement is socialized to get feedback as an evaluation and perfection of the vision and mission. The achievement of vision and mission that have been determined must be known, understood, and implemented by all academicians including students. This research was conducted to measure the level of students' understanding of the vision and mission of Biology Education Study Program of FKIP Untan. This research used qualitative approach with descriptive study. The subjects in this research were 246 students of Biology Education Study Program of FKIP Untan class of 2015, 2016, and 2017. The research instrument used was a questionnaire with closed and open statement. The results of this study indicated that in general the students have understood the vision and mission well. Data analysis showed that 236 (95,93%) students have read vision and mission, 190 (77,24%) and 204 (82,93%) students knew about vision and mission, 203 (33,44%), 101 (64%) students were the highest percentage of students who read the vision and mission in standing banner or class and in academic guidance book. Furthermore, 162 students (65.85 %) agreed that they have been well informed about the vision and mission, 165 students (67.07%) agreed that they have understood the vision and mission, 173 students (70.33%) agreed with the existence of vision and mission, and 159 students (64.63%) agreed that the vision and mission were used as references.</p>

One of Indonesian Goverment policies in Educational sectors is to reinforce vocational education pattern policy named Vocational High School with Dual Responsibiluty System. Current research is learning effectiveness of Dual Resposbility Sustem at Vocational schools located in Pontianak, which aimed at investigates empirically all the variables affect Dual Responsiility System  partially and also to find out the determinate factors on Dual Responsibility System. Survey with questionnaire is deployed for data collecting with 135 respondents valid for further analyzed. Validity, reliabilty and classic assumption were used for measurement and Likert Scale for variable measurement as well. Data analysis and variable analyzes, current study highlights that teachers competency andlearning facility shows a significant impact on Dual Responsibility System. In another hands, the finding shows also showed that exogent variable has asignificant impact on endogen with R Square 52,6%,  0,430. This research suggests that each vocational schools to apply ARCS in motivating the students as well as the innovation, maintenance of learning facilities usage. Moreover, it’s also suggest that goverment especially Educational Department of Pontianak to evaluate the effectiveness of Dual Responsibilty System Implementation in Vocational High Schools in Pontianak.
